ASSIZE OF MORT D' ANCESTOR. The name, of an ancient writ, now obsolete. It
might have been sued out by one whose father, mother, brother, &c., died
seised of lands, and tonements, which they held in fee, and which, after
their death, a stranger abated. Reg. Orig. 223. See Mort d' Ancestor.
